john deere 4300
For no apparent reason, 3 pt hitch arms quit lifting.

Re: john deere 4300
Look at the posts related to your hydraulic system - I have the same problem, as well as the loader not lifting, and a hydraulic oil change along w/ screen cleaning & filter replacement should do it.

Re: john deere 4300
If hydraulic fluid gets over heated it will fail causing your hydraulic system to fail for sure do like the other post says change filter fluid and check screens for wear of chips from gears or casting build up blocking screen intake!
